Booking and Pricing
At $249 per group, up to four people, the cost is quite reasonable considering the size and novelty of the paddleboard. When you break down the price, it’s roughly $62 a person if you go with a full four-person group—less than some single-person paddleboard rentals in the area, with the bonus of shared fun. This fee covers a 14-foot giant SUP Mantaray, lifejackets, paddles, and a certified guide who will give you instructions and ensure your safety.
You can choose a duration from about one to five hours, making it flexible whether you want a quick paddle or a lazy, sun-soaked afternoon. Keep in mind that the park entry fee of $25 per booking is included if you opt for transportation, but if you’re self-driving, you’ll need to cover that separately.
Meeting Point and Location
The activity kicks off at 25650 Willow Beach Rd, meaning you’ll be right at the water’s edge, with easy access to scenic views and wildlife. The area is famous for petroglyphs, beaches for swimming, and caves like Emerald Cave and Echo Cave, which are just a couple of miles from the marina. It’s the perfect playground for a day of exploring both on and off the water.
If you’re interested in combining your paddleboard trip with other local attractions, the historic trail to Gauger’s House offers a fantastic view of the Black Canyon, just a paddle away from the marina.

The Scenic and Wildlife Setting
Willow Beach is a quieter alternative to the more crowded Lake Mead beaches, and it’s surrounded by rugged desert landscapes. During the trip, you might see wildlife like waterfowl or even some of the area’s petroglyphs, which add a hint of history to your adventure.
The caves nearby, such as Emerald and Echo Cave, are accessible for exploration if you’re up for a side trip, adding a touch of adventure beyond paddling. The Black Canyon, visible from the trail to Gauger’s House, offers a stunning backdrop for your day’s activities.

FAQ
Is this activity suitable for children?
Yes, the giant SUP is designed to be easy to handle and stable, making it suitable for all ages, including kids, so long as they are comfortable around water and under supervision.
What does the rental include?
Your rental includes the 14-foot Mantaray giant SUP, lifejackets, paddles, and instruction from a certified guide to help you get started safely and confidently.
How long can I rent the paddleboard?
The experience typically lasts between 1 and 5 hours, allowing you to choose a duration that fits your schedule and energy level.
Are there any additional costs?
Yes, the National Park Fee of $25 per booking is included if you opt for transportation. Otherwise, if you self-drive, you’ll pay that fee separately. Bottled water and snacks aren’t included but are recommended for a comfortable trip.
Do I need prior paddleboarding experience?
No, beginners of all skill levels are welcome. The guides provide basic instructions, and the stability of the giant board makes it easy for newcomers to enjoy the activity.
Is transportation provided?
This tour offers a mobile ticket, and transportation options may be included or optional, depending on your booking. Check your specific reservation details to confirm if transportation is included.
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und. Cancellations made less than 24 hours before the activity start time are not refundable.
